Browse Source

uclibc-ng: fix packaging, when git version is choosen

Waldemar Brodkorb 8 years ago
parent
commit
684dfda0bd
1 changed files with 4 additions and 5 deletions
  1. 4 5
      package/uclibc-ng/Makefile

+ 4 - 5
package/uclibc-ng/Makefile

@@ -10,7 +10,6 @@ PKG_NAME:=		uClibc-ng
 PKG_DESCR:=		embedded c library
 PKG_SECTION:=		base/libs
 PKG_OPTS:=		noremove nostaging noscripts
-PKG_VER:=		$(PKG_VERSION)
 
 PKG_SUBPKGS:=		UCLIBC_NG UCLIBC_NG_DEV UCLIBC_NG_TEST
 PKGSD_UCLIBC_NG_DEV:=	development files for uclibc-ng
@@ -37,14 +36,14 @@ do-install:
 	    cut -f 2 > $(IDIR_UCLIBC_NG)/etc/TZ
 ifneq ($(ADK_TARGET_USE_STATIC_LIBS)$(ADK_TARGET_BINFMT_FLAT),y)
 	$(CP) $(STAGING_TARGET_DIR)/lib/libc.so.* $(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H)
-	$(CP) $(STAGING_TARGET_DIR)/lib/libuClibc-$(PKG_VER).so \
+	$(CP) $(STAGING_TARGET_DIR)/lib/libuClibc-*.so \
 		$(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H)
-	$(CP) $(STAGING_TARGET_DIR)/lib/ld*-uClibc-$(PKG_VER).so \
+	$(CP) $(STAGING_TARGET_DIR)/lib/ld*-uClibc-*.so \
 		$(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H)
 	$(CP) $(STAGING_TARGET_DIR)/lib/ld*-uClibc.so.* $(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H)
 	-for file in libcrypt libdl libm libresolv libutil libuargp; do \
 		$(CP) $(STAGING_TARGET_DIR)/lib/$$file.so* $(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H); \
-		$(CP) $(STAGING_TARGET_DIR)/lib/$$file-$(PKG_VER).so \
+		$(CP) $(STAGING_TARGET_DIR)/lib/$$file-*.so \
 			$(IDIR_UCLIBC_NG)/$(ADK_TARGET_LIBC_PATH); \
 	done
 endif
@@ -55,7 +54,7 @@ uclibc-ng-dev-install:
 	${CP} ${STAGING_TARGET_DIR}/usr/lib/uclibc_nonshared.a ${IDIR_UCLIBC_NG_DEV}/usr/lib
 	${CP} ${STAGING_TARGET_DIR}/usr/lib/crt*.o ${IDIR_UCLIBC_NG_DEV}/usr/lib
 	for file in libcrypt libdl libm libresolv libutil libuargp; do \
-		cd $(IDIR_UCLIBC_NG_DEV)/$(ADK_TARGET_LIBC_PATH); ln -sf $$file-$(PKG_VER).so $$file.so; \
+		cd $(IDIR_UCLIBC_NG_DEV)/$(ADK_TARGET_LIBC_PATH); ln -sf $$file-$(PKG_VERSION).so $$file.so; \
 	done
 	${KERNEL_MAKE_ENV} \
 	$(MAKE) -C $(TOOLCHAIN_BUILD_DIR)/w-linux-$(KERNEL_VERSION)/linux-$(KERNEL_FILE_VER) \